Sennheiser MMD 835 - 1BK

Product information "Sennheiser MMD 835 - 1BK"

Microphone module from the renowned evolution 800 series with consistent directional characteristics (cardioid) and powerful sound for a wide range of applications. Compatible with all handheld transmitters of the ew G3, ew G4, D1, AVX, SpeechLine Digital Wireless and 2000 series.

Specifications

Sound pressure level at 1 kHz: 154 dB

Converter principle: dynamic

Directional characteristic: cardioid

Sensitivity, transmission factor: 2.1 mV / Pa

Manufacturer "Sennheiser"
Sennheiser stands for excellent quality and enjoys great popularity in the music sector worldwide. Sennheiser's product range includes headphones, microphones, wireless microphone systems, conference and information systems as well as aviation and audiology products.
Sennheiser mainly produces for the music industry, aviation and the entertainment industry. In addition, Sennheiser produces consumer electronics for private customers. The company's first independently developed microphone was the MD2, which they introduced to the market in 1947. The first shotgun microphone followed in 1956. A year later, Sennheiser manufactured 100 different product types. The world's first open headphones appeared in 1968, heralding the success story of Sennheiser headphones. Infrared transmission technology followed in the 1970s and multi-channel wireless transmission in the 1980s. In the early 1990s, Sennheiser produced a limited edition of the famous Sennheiser Orpheus - a handcrafted, electrostatic headphone driven directly by a tube amplifier - which is said to be the most expensive headphone in the world.

Sennheiser worldwide
The Sennheiser Group based in Wedemark (Hanover region) is one of the world's leading manufacturers of microphones, headphones and wireless transmission systems. In 2007, the family business, founded in Germany in 1945, achieved sales of more than 395 million euros with a foreign share of over 83%. Sennheiser has almost 2000 employees worldwide, 56% of them in Germany. Sennheiser manufactures in Germany, Ireland and the USA and is represented worldwide by subsidiaries in France, Great Britain, Belgium, the Netherlands, Germany, Denmark (Nordic), Russia, Hong Kong, India, Singapore, Japan, China, Canada, Mexico and the USA as well as through long-term trading partners in many other countries. The companies Georg Neumann GmbH, Berlin (studio microphones), K + H Vertriebs- und Entwicklungsgesellschaft mbH (Klein + Hummel studio monitors, installed sound) and the joint venture Sennheiser Communications A/S (headsets for PC, office and call centers) also belong to Sennheiser Group.

Fender 351 Guitar Seat / Stand
Ideal for any guitarist or bassist, this combination seat and guitar stand makes it easy to have a productive practice session or survive a long performance. Comfortably padded for long playing sessions, the seat and Fender 351 pick-shaped backrest with embroidered "F" logo are covered in woven gray tweed fabric. The flip-up/down instrument cradle—designed to fit most guitars and basses—displays your instrument securely while the integrated crossbar footrest accommodates almost any leg position. Designed for easy transport, the seat legs fold and the backrest is removable to make it even more compact when headed to a gig.Color: BlackDimensions: 5.30x16.60x35.40 InchWeigh: 16.26 LB
